How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Valle Vista?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Valle Vista Studio Apartments | $2,190 | $1,250 | $2,720 |
Valle Vista 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,624 | $2,100 | $3,695 |
Valle Vista 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,348 | $2,400 | $6,310 |
Valle Vista 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,766 | $3,400 | $4,300 |
Valle Vista 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,746 | $1,660 | $1,905 |
